Lost on Mars 2002
In 2002, Eric Shook directed the sci-fi action movie Lost on Mars, a gripping tale of space exploration gone awry. The film follows a routine Martian space mission that takes an unexpected turn when Earth receives a mysterious signal from a Martian probe.

About Lost on Mars (2002) — A Thrilling Adventure Through Space
In 2002, Eric Shook directed the sci-fi action movie Lost on Mars, a gripping tale of space exploration gone awry. The film follows a routine Martian space mission that takes an unexpected turn when Earth receives a mysterious signal from a Martian probe. This thrilling adventure, filled with suspense and action, sets the stage for the sequel Empire of Danger. With a talented cast, including Kelli Wilson and Eric Shook, Lost on Mars explores the unknown dangers of space travel and the thrill of discovery. As the crew navigates the harsh Martian environment, they must confront the unknown to survive.
